Read moreAustralia is incredibly lucky to be on the edge of the epic annual migration of humpback, southern right whales and the rare blue whale. Whale watching is an incredible, unique experience that everyone should do at least once in their lifetime.
Between May and December (depending on the state), whales make their way along each coastline, often with calves that can be seen from land, or even better, by boat.
